
在Excel中大批向下填充公式的方法:使用填充柄、使用快捷键、使用表格功能、使用VBA宏。其中,使用填充柄是最简单且最常用的方法。
使用填充柄的方法非常直观,也非常高效。首先选择要填充公式的单元格,然后将鼠标放在单元格右下角的小方块上,当鼠标变成黑色十字时,按住左键向下拖动,这样就可以将公式填充到所需的范围。这种方法适用于公式需要填充到相邻的单元格中。
一、使用填充柄
填充柄是Excel中的一个非常方便的工具,可以快速将一个单元格的内容复制到相邻的单元格中。
1、基本操作
首先,选择包含公式的单元格。将鼠标指针移动到单元格右下角的小方块上,这时鼠标指针会变成一个黑色十字。按住左键并向下拖动鼠标,将公式填充到所需的范围。松开鼠标按钮,公式将自动填充到所有选中的单元格中。
2、双击填充柄
如果需要将公式填充到一个很长的列中,可以双击填充柄。选择包含公式的单元格,将鼠标指针移动到单元格右下角的小方块上。当鼠标指针变成黑色十字时,双击鼠标左键,Excel会自动将公式填充到该列中有数据的所有单元格中。
二、使用快捷键
使用快捷键也可以快速实现大批向下填充公式,这种方法特别适用于需要填充大量数据的情况。
1、基本操作
首先,选择包含公式的单元格,然后按住Shift键并选择需要填充公式的所有单元格。接下来,按Ctrl+D键,Excel会将第一个单元格的公式复制到所有选中的单元格中。
2、使用Ctrl+Enter键
另一种快捷键方法是使用Ctrl+Enter键。首先,选择包含公式的单元格,然后按住Shift键选择需要填充公式的所有单元格。接下来,按F2键进入编辑模式,然后按Ctrl+Enter键,Excel会将公式填充到所有选中的单元格中。
三、使用表格功能
将数据转换为表格格式,可以自动扩展公式到新添加的行中,非常适合处理动态数据。
1、将数据转换为表格
首先,选择包含数据的单元格区域,然后点击“插入”选项卡,选择“表格”。在弹出的对话框中确认选择的单元格区域并点击“确定”。此时,Excel会将数据转换为表格格式。
2、自动扩展公式
在表格中输入公式后,当向表格中添加新行时,Excel会自动将公式扩展到新添加的行中。这样可以确保所有新添加的数据都包含相同的公式。
四、使用VBA宏
对于需要经常进行大批量填充公式的任务,可以编写VBA宏来自动化这一过程。
1、打开VBA编辑器
按Alt+F11键打开VBA编辑器,然后点击“插入”菜单,选择“模块”来插入一个新的模块。
2、编写宏代码
在新的模块中输入以下代码:
Sub FillDownFormula()
Dim ws As Worksheet
Dim rng As Range
Set ws = ThisWorkbook.Sheets("Sheet1") ' 替换为你的工作表名称
Set rng = ws.Range("A1:A10") ' 替换为你的公式范围
rng.FillDown
End Sub
3、运行宏
按F5键运行宏,Excel会自动将公式填充到指定的范围中。
五、使用Power Query
Power Query是一个功能强大的数据处理工具,可以用来自动化数据处理任务,包括公式填充。
1、打开Power Query
选择包含数据的单元格区域,然后点击“数据”选项卡,选择“从表格/范围”。Excel会打开Power Query编辑器。
2、应用公式
在Power Query编辑器中,可以添加计算列并应用公式。完成后,点击“关闭并加载”将处理后的数据加载回Excel。
六、使用数组公式
数组公式可以一次性计算多个单元格的值,适用于需要在多个单元格中应用相同计算逻辑的情况。
1、输入数组公式
选择需要输入数组公式的单元格区域,然后输入公式,并按Ctrl+Shift+Enter键。Excel会自动将公式应用到选中的所有单元格中。
七、使用动态数组
Excel中的动态数组功能可以自动扩展公式,适用于处理动态数据。
1、输入动态数组公式
在单元格中输入动态数组公式,然后按Enter键。Excel会自动将公式应用到相邻的单元格中。
八、使用自定义函数
可以编写自定义函数来处理复杂的计算逻辑,并在多个单元格中应用该函数。
1、编写自定义函数
按Alt+F11键打开VBA编辑器,然后点击“插入”菜单,选择“模块”来插入一个新的模块。在新的模块中输入自定义函数的代码。
Function CustomFormula(value As Double) As Double
CustomFormula = value * 2 ' 替换为你的计算逻辑
End Function
2、应用自定义函数
在Excel中输入自定义函数,并将其应用到需要的单元格中。
九、使用数据填充工具
Excel中的数据填充工具可以快速将一个单元格的内容复制到相邻的单元格中。
1、使用数据填充工具
选择包含数据的单元格,然后点击“数据”选项卡,选择“填充”。在弹出的对话框中选择“向下填充”,Excel会将数据填充到相邻的单元格中。
十、使用公式复制
可以使用公式复制功能将一个单元格的公式复制到其他单元格中。
1、复制公式
选择包含公式的单元格,然后按Ctrl+C键复制公式。接下来,选择需要填充公式的单元格区域,按Ctrl+V键粘贴公式。
十一、使用自动填充
Excel中的自动填充功能可以根据数据模式自动填充单元格。
1、使用自动填充
选择包含数据的单元格,然后将鼠标指针移动到单元格右下角的小方块上。当鼠标指针变成黑色十字时,按住左键并向下拖动鼠标,Excel会根据数据模式自动填充单元格。
十二、使用数据验证
可以使用数据验证功能来限制单元格的输入内容,并确保公式的正确性。
1、设置数据验证
选择需要设置数据验证的单元格区域,然后点击“数据”选项卡,选择“数据验证”。在弹出的对话框中设置数据验证条件。
十三、使用条件格式
可以使用条件格式来突出显示包含公式的单元格,并确保公式的正确性。
1、设置条件格式
选择需要设置条件格式的单元格区域,然后点击“开始”选项卡,选择“条件格式”。在弹出的对话框中设置条件格式规则。
十四、使用数据透视表
数据透视表是一个功能强大的数据分析工具,可以用来汇总和分析数据。
1、创建数据透视表
选择包含数据的单元格区域,然后点击“插入”选项卡,选择“数据透视表”。在弹出的对话框中选择数据源和目标位置,然后点击“确定”。
十五、使用图表
图表是一个直观的数据显示工具,可以用来可视化数据。
1、创建图表
选择包含数据的单元格区域,然后点击“插入”选项卡,选择图表类型。在弹出的对话框中设置图表参数。
十六、使用公式审查
公式审查是一个功能强大的工具,可以用来检查和调试公式。
1、使用公式审查
选择包含公式的单元格,然后点击“公式”选项卡,选择“公式审查”。在弹出的对话框中查看公式的计算过程。
十七、使用单元格引用
可以使用单元格引用来确保公式的正确性,并减少出错的机会。
1、使用单元格引用
在公式中使用单元格引用,而不是直接输入数值。这样可以确保公式的灵活性和正确性。
十八、使用命名区域
可以使用命名区域来简化公式,并提高公式的可读性。
1、创建命名区域
选择包含数据的单元格区域,然后点击“公式”选项卡,选择“定义名称”。在弹出的对话框中输入名称并点击“确定”。
十九、使用数组常量
数组常量是一个功能强大的工具,可以用来简化公式,并提高公式的效率。
1、使用数组常量
在公式中使用数组常量,而不是直接输入数值。这样可以提高公式的效率和可读性。
二十、使用动态命名区域
动态命名区域是一个功能强大的工具,可以用来处理动态数据。
1、创建动态命名区域
选择包含数据的单元格区域,然后点击“公式”选项卡,选择“定义名称”。在弹出的对话框中输入名称和公式,并点击“确定”。
二十一、使用公式管理器
公式管理器是一个功能强大的工具,可以用来管理和调试公式。
1、使用公式管理器
选择包含公式的单元格,然后点击“公式”选项卡,选择“公式管理器”。在弹出的对话框中查看和编辑公式。
二十二、使用脚本
脚本是一个功能强大的工具,可以用来自动化数据处理任务。
1、编写脚本
按Alt+F11键打开VBA编辑器,然后点击“插入”菜单,选择“模块”来插入一个新的模块。在新的模块中输入脚本代码。
Sub FillDownFormula()
Dim ws As Worksheet
Dim rng As Range
Set ws = ThisWorkbook.Sheets("Sheet1") ' 替换为你的工作表名称
Set rng = ws.Range("A1:A10") ' 替换为你的公式范围
rng.FillDown
End Sub
2、运行脚本
按F5键运行脚本,Excel会自动将公式填充到指定的范围中。
二十三、使用插件
可以使用Excel插件来扩展Excel的功能,并实现自动化数据处理任务。
1、安装插件
从官方网站下载并安装Excel插件,然后按照插件说明进行设置。
2、使用插件
按照插件说明使用插件功能,实现自动化数据处理任务。
二十四、使用网络函数
Excel中的网络函数可以用来处理和分析网络数据。
1、使用网络函数
在公式中使用网络函数来处理和分析网络数据。这样可以提高公式的效率和准确性。
二十五、使用数据分析工具
数据分析工具是一个功能强大的数据处理和分析工具,可以用来处理和分析大量数据。
1、使用数据分析工具
选择包含数据的单元格区域,然后点击“数据”选项卡,选择“数据分析”。在弹出的对话框中选择数据分析工具并进行设置。
二十六、使用分列功能
分列功能是一个功能强大的数据处理工具,可以用来将一个单元格的内容拆分到多个单元格中。
1、使用分列功能
选择包含数据的单元格,然后点击“数据”选项卡,选择“分列”。在弹出的对话框中设置分列参数。
二十七、使用文本函数
文本函数是一个功能强大的工具,可以用来处理和分析文本数据。
1、使用文本函数
在公式中使用文本函数来处理和分析文本数据。这样可以提高公式的效率和准确性。
二十八、使用数学函数
数学函数是一个功能强大的工具,可以用来处理和分析数值数据。
1、使用数学函数
在公式中使用数学函数来处理和分析数值数据。这样可以提高公式的效率和准确性。
二十九、使用统计函数
统计函数是一个功能强大的工具,可以用来处理和分析统计数据。
1、使用统计函数
在公式中使用统计函数来处理和分析统计数据。这样可以提高公式的效率和准确性。
三十、使用逻辑函数
逻辑函数是一个功能强大的工具,可以用来处理和分析逻辑数据。
1、使用逻辑函数
在公式中使用逻辑函数来处理和分析逻辑数据。这样可以提高公式的效率和准确性。
相关问答FAQs:
1. 如何在Excel中大批向下填充公式?
在Excel中,您可以使用以下方法来大批向下填充公式:
- 选中包含公式的单元格。 首先,选中包含公式的单元格或单元格范围。
- 将鼠标悬停在选中区域的右下角。 将鼠标悬停在选中区域的右下角,直到光标变为加号或黑十字。
- 拖动鼠标向下。 按住鼠标左键,拖动鼠标向下,直到您希望填充的单元格数量达到预期。
- 释放鼠标。 当您达到所需的填充范围时,释放鼠标左键即可完成大批向下填充公式。
请注意,Excel会自动调整公式中的相对引用,以适应填充范围的变化。如果您希望保持某些单元格的引用不变,可以使用绝对引用(如$A$1)或混合引用(如$A1或A$1)来指定。
2. 如何在Excel中向下填充公式到特定行?
如果您希望将公式向下填充到特定行,可以使用以下方法:
- 选中要填充公式的单元格。 首先,选中包含公式的单元格或单元格范围。
- 按住Shift键并选择目标行。 按住Shift键,使用鼠标或方向键选择您希望填充公式的目标行。
- 按下Ctrl + D键。 按下Ctrl + D键,Excel会将选中的公式向下填充到目标行。
请注意,这种方法只适用于向下填充公式。如果您需要将公式向上填充或在非连续的行中填充,可以使用其他方法,如拖动鼠标或使用填充功能。
3. 如何在Excel中大批向下填充自定义序列?
除了填充公式,您还可以在Excel中使用自定义序列进行大批向下填充。以下是一种简单的方法:
- 输入起始值。 在一个单元格中输入序列的起始值。
- 选中包含起始值的单元格和要填充的单元格范围。 选中包含起始值的单元格和要填充的单元格范围。
- 将鼠标悬停在选中区域的右下角。 将鼠标悬停在选中区域的右下角,直到光标变为加号或黑十字。
- 拖动鼠标向下。 按住鼠标左键,拖动鼠标向下,直到您希望填充的单元格数量达到预期。
- 释放鼠标。 当您达到所需的填充范围时,释放鼠标左键即可完成大批向下填充自定义序列。
您可以使用这种方法创建各种自定义序列,如数字序列、日期序列、文本序列等。如果需要进一步自定义序列,可以使用“填充”功能或自定义列表选项。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4274925